选择 Windows Server 2022 还是 Windows Server 2019,主要取决于你的业务需求、安全要求、硬件环境以及未来规划。以下是详细的对比和建议,帮助你做出决策:
一、核心差异概览
| 项目 | Windows Server 2022 | Windows Server 2019 |
|---|---|---|
| 发布时间 | 2021年8月 | 2019年11月 |
| 支持周期(主流支持) | 至2026年10月,扩展支持至2031年 | 至2024年1月,扩展支持至2029年 |
| 安全性增强 | 更强:支持TLS 1.3、Secured-core Server、虚拟化安全启动(VBS)、基于虚拟化的安全(VBS)等 | 基础安全功能完善,但无最新加密协议和防护 |
| 性能优化 | 针对容器、云原生应用优化更好 | 良好,但不如2022新 |
| .NET / 容器支持 | 更新的运行时支持,更适合现代应用开发 | 支持较旧版本,需额外配置更新 |
| 硬件兼容性 | 更适合新硬件(如支持TPM 2.0、UEFI安全启动等) | 兼容性强,适合老旧或中端硬件 |
| Azure 集成 | 更紧密集成 Azure Arc、Azure Automanage、Hybrid Benefit | 支持混合云,但功能略弱 |
二、选择建议
✅ 推荐选择 Windows Server 2022 的情况:
-
追求更高的安全性
- 需要 TLS 1.3 加密通信
- 启用 Secured-core Server(防固件攻击)
- 使用基于虚拟化的安全(VBS)保护内存
- 企业合规要求高(如X_X、X_X)
-
计划长期使用(5年以上)
- 2022的支持周期更长,可减少未来升级压力
-
部署在新硬件或云端
- 新服务器通常支持 TPM、安全启动等功能,能充分发挥2022优势
-
构建混合云或容器化环境
- 更好的 Azure 集成
- 支持更新版的 Windows Containers 和 Kubernetes 集成
-
希望减少补丁和维护频率
- Server 2022 提供“长期服务频道”(LTSC),稳定性强,更新更可控
✅ 推荐选择 Windows Server 2019 的情况:
-
现有环境稳定,暂无升级必要
- 如果当前系统运行良好,且应用兼容性已验证,无需强行升级
-
硬件较老或不支持新安全特性
- 老服务器可能缺少 TPM 2.0 或 UEFI 安全启动,无法启用2022的新功能
-
第三方软件/应用仅认证支持2019
- 某些传统ERP、数据库或工业软件可能尚未通过2022认证
-
预算有限,或短期内会迁移到云/其他平台
- 若计划2-3年内上云或改用Linux,2019仍可满足过渡期需求
三、其他考虑因素
| 维度 | 建议 |
|---|---|
| 许可证兼容性 | Server 2022 可使用部分旧许可升级(如SA),但需确认微软授权条款 |
| Hyper-V 虚拟化 | 2022 提供更好的性能和安全隔离(如Host Guardian Service改进) |
| 存储与文件服务 | 两者差异不大,但2022对Storage Replica支持更优 |
| 远程桌面服务(RDS) | 功能基本一致,但2022更稳定、兼容新客户端 |
四、总结:一句话决策指南
🔹 选 Windows Server 2022:如果你从零开始部署、注重安全、使用新硬件、计划长期运行或拥抱混合云。
🔹 选 Windows Server 2019:如果你已有稳定环境、硬件老旧、应用兼容性受限,或短期内无重大变更计划。
五、附加建议
- 测试先行:无论选择哪个版本,建议先在测试环境中验证关键应用的兼容性。
- 关注生命周期:Server 2019 的主流支持将于 2024年1月结束,之后不再接收新功能,仅提供安全更新。
- 考虑 Windows Server 2025:微软预计2024年底发布 Server 2025,若项目不急,可观望是否值得跳过2022直接升级到下一代。
如有具体应用场景(如域控制器、SQL Server、Exchange、文件服务器等),欢迎补充,我可以给出更精准的建议。
CLOUD云计算